Crime, Justice and Society BA Hons

The BA (Hons) Crime, Justice, and Society course explores the relationship between crime, criminal behaviour, and the societal systems established to address and prevent crime.

Asked for: 112 UCAS Tariff points

English language requirements

6.0
Additional details
IELTS 6.0 overall (minimum 5.5 in all components) where English is not the students' first language.
